Abstract: | This paper studies the control of pH neutralization processes using fuzzy controllers. As the process to be controlled is highly nonlinear the usual PI-type fuzzy controller is not able to control these systems adequately. To solve this problem, based on prior knowledge of the process, the pH neutralization process is divided into several fuzzy regions such as high-gain, medium-gain and low-gain, with an auxiliary variable used to detect the process operation region. Then, a fuzzy logic controller can also be designed using this auxiliary variable as input, giving adequate performance in all regions. This controller has been tested in real-time on a laboratory plant. On-line results show that the designed control system operates the plant in a range of pH values, despite perturbations and variations of the plant parameters, obtaining good performance at the desired working points. |
